Historic Sanborn Fire Insurance Maps are some of the best visual records of how American towns once looked. For places like Paia, they can help reveal how the community was laid out, where businesses operated, and how the town changed over time.

Why these maps matter

Old maps of Paia can help bring local history to life. They often show the footprint of downtown, labeled businesses, industrial buildings, hotels, schools, and other landmarks that mattered to everyday life.

Whether you are researching family roots, local history, or simply want to see how Paia once looked, these maps are a direct window into the town’s past.
